What is the biggest trend in pharmaceutical cleanrooms?

The most significant trend is the shift from manual operation to data-driven management, where all environmental parameters are continuously monitored and analyzed in real time to optimize performance and reduce GMP risks.

What is a smart cleanroom?

A smart cleanroom integrates HVAC, monitoring systems, BMS, and data analytics platforms, enabling automatic adjustment of environmental conditions based on real-time operational needs rather than fixed settings.

What role does AI play in cleanrooms?

AI is used to analyze monitoring data, predict deviations, optimize HVAC performance, and support decision-making, helping to improve efficiency and reduce risks.

What are the trends in HVAC systems?

HVAC systems are moving toward energy-efficient designs, including variable frequency drives, demand-based control, and optimized airflow instead of constant high-load operation.

How will monitoring systems evolve?

Monitoring systems will become central platforms that not only collect data but also analyze trends, provide early warnings, and support operational decisions.

Is there a trend toward lower cleanliness levels?

The trend is not to reduce cleanliness but to apply the appropriate level based on risk, avoiding overdesign.

Are modular cleanrooms a trend?

Yes, modular cleanrooms enable faster construction, easier expansion, and greater flexibility for production needs.

Will FFU systems grow in the future?

FFUs will continue to be used in flexible and modular applications but must be integrated with overall control systems to meet GMP requirements.

What are the trends in cleanroom materials?

Materials are evolving to be more durable, easier to clean, antimicrobial, and low particle-generating.

What are the trends in energy efficiency?

Energy optimization is a major trend, including reduced airflow where possible, optimized pressure control, and energy-saving technologies.

What are the trends in data and digitalization?

Data is becoming central, with enhanced capabilities for storage, retrieval, analysis, and audit support.

What are the trends in GMP compliance?

GMP is shifting from periodic inspection to continuous monitoring, requiring transparent and real-time data.

Will cleanrooms use IoT?

Yes, IoT enables integration of devices into a connected ecosystem for synchronized data collection and control.

What are the trends in validation?

Validation is moving toward continuous verification using real-time data instead of one-time testing.

What are the trends in workforce requirements?

Personnel will need skills in data analysis and smart system operation, not just equipment handling.

What are the trends in cleanroom design?

Design is moving toward flexibility, scalability, and ease of operation.

What are the trends in GMP audits?

Audits will increasingly focus on data integrity and continuous control rather than only documentation.

What are the trends in pharmaceutical products?

Growth in biologics, vaccines, and personalized medicine requires more flexible and higher-control cleanroom environments.

What is risk-based design?

Risk-based design focuses on aligning cleanroom specifications with actual process risks to optimize both performance and cost.

What is the most important trend?

The most important trend is the transition from static control to dynamic, data-driven control.

How will future cleanrooms ensure GMP compliance?

Future cleanrooms will ensure GMP compliance through continuous data monitoring, automation, and rapid response to deviations, maintaining consistent control and optimized performance.
